
Ongoing Research Projects At CAMRET
| #S/NO | RESEARCH TITLE | PRINCIPAL INVESTIGATOR | 1 | Rapid Identification and evaluation of potential therapeutics for COVID-19 | Prof. Shuaibu O. Bello (Pharmacology and Therapeutics) |
|---|---|---|
| 2 | Pre-clinical studies and standardization of Ochna Kibbiensis leaves extract for use as a potential brain cancer therapy | Prof. Ismail Musa (Pharmaceutical and Medicinal Chemistry) |
| 3 | In-vivo anti-colon cancer investigation and mechanism of action studies of 5-methylcoumarin-4β-glucoside isolated from Vernonia glaberrima (Welw. ex O.Hoffm.) H. Rob. | Dr. Mustapha Umar Imam (Molecular Medicine and Nutrigenomics) |
| 4 | Epigenetic implications of perinatal hypozincemia on offsprings' cardiometabolic health | Dr. Mustapha Umar Imam (Molecular Medicine and Nutrigenomics) |
| 5 | White rice and transgenerational risk of insulin resistance | Dr. Mustapha Umar Imam (Molecular Medicine and Nutrigenomics) |
| 6 | Rational design and generation of a specific antivenom targeting carpet viper snake (Echis ocellatus) toxins using a recombinant DNA immunisation approach. | Dr. Bashir Muhammad Bello (Vaccinology and molecular virology) |
| 7 | Development of a polyvalent DNA vaccine for the prevention of Lassa fever in Nigeria. | Dr. Bashir Muhammad Bello (Vaccinology and molecular virology) |
| 8 | Aortic function in Hypertensive heart failure with a preserved ejection fraction. | Dr Adamu Jibril Bamaiyi (Cardiovascular physiology and diseases) |
| 9 | Impact of CYP3A4 and CYP3A5 single nucleotide polymorphisms as risk factors for hypertension in pregnancy among women of African descent. | Dr Murtala Bello Abubakar (CELLULAR AND MOLECULAR PHYSIOLOGY) |
| 10 | Accelerated development of COVID-19 vaccine using recombinant DNA and engineered viral vector platforms. | Dr Bashir Muhammad Bello (Vaccinology and molecular virology) |
| 11 | Development of a qPCR panel (Fevertroph) for accurate diagnosis of Tropical fever. | Dr Bashir Muhammad Bello (Vaccinology and molecular virology) |
| 12 | Diagnostic potential of gene expression signatures of breast cancer. | Dr. Mustapha Umar Imam (Molecular Medicine and Nutrigenomics) |
